What´s "the dragon awakens"?

I think the author of the mod was vaguely inspired by WoD vampires... but only vaguely. The other vampire mod goes full WoD and there is no normal gameplay. In this one you have mostly feature-complete vampires (though they only work on the basis of their own religion... and don´t work well as playable republics). As a result they cannot join any society (partially compensated by having their own vampire powers). Also, non-vampires hate them. As a result they´re fun to play, but less tough than you would expect, and you have to be careful with wars because even people who dislike each other might dogpile on you. The vampire Byzantines tend to expand slow and steady, untill they get slapped down by a particularily successful crusade or jihad and suddenly lose a big chunk of their territory. Another consequence is that crusades and jiihads tend to be aimed at vampires rather than at each other. All in all the early game is very chaotic.  It´s kind of interesting to watch it happen TBH

I don’t think they’ve confirmed female merchant republics yet. You can create a female Doge in Ruler Designer but are still stuck with agnatic afterwards, so we might be looking at something similar (random generator’s put women in charge of republics but the laws are unchanged). They do have those pagan reformation doctrines for a fully matriarchal society, though, so it could very well be possible.

I wonder if the randomization "intelligence" will be tied to the real world map by hardcode or if it will be useable with modded maps too
They said in that thread (Show Dev Only Responses is great) that they're explicitly going to include as much documentation as possible for modders, and assuming the mod doesn't do something whacked out insane, it should be drop-and-use for most mods, even ones with completely different maps. Game of Thrones was specifically asked in the question that that was a response to.

E: Elder Kings, not Game of Thrones.

"It should theoretically work with any map or mod, provided it has everything set up properly (the duchy structure, cultures, religions, etc)."

"Generally all you'll need is to have a functioning mod already to use it, any other tweaks will be to what part of the random generation rules you use or tweak as some are vanilla specific. We've included lots of text info files in the folders detailing how to use the new features modding wise so modders can get it up and running, and of course the user mod section of the forum can have questions posted in it as usual :)"
